实验4

#include <stdio.h>
#define N 4
int main()
{
    int a[N] = {2, 0, 2, 2};
    char b[N] = {'2', '0', '2', '2'};
    int i;
    printf("sizeof(int) = %d\n", sizeof(int));
    printf("sizeof(char) = %d\n", sizeof(char));
    printf("\n");

    for (i = 0; i < N; ++i)
    printf("%p: %d\n", &a[i], a[i]);
    printf("\n");

    for (i = 0; i < N; ++i)
    printf("%p: %c\n", &b[i], b[i]);
    printf("\n");

    printf("a = %p\n", a);
    printf("b = %p\n", b);
    return 0;
}

a,连续存放,4个。

b,连续存放,1个。

数组名a对应的值和&a[0]一样,数组名b对应的值和&b[0]一样.

TASK3

#include<stdio.h>
int days_of_year(int year, int month, int day);
int main()
{
    int year, month, day;
    int days;
    while (scanf("%d%d%d", &year, &month, &day) != EOF)
    {
        days = days_of_year(year, month, day);
        printf("%4d-%02d-%02d是这一年中的第%d天.\n\n", year, month, day, days);
    }
    return 0;
}
int days_of_year(int year, int month, int day)
{
    int n=0;
    int i;
    int x[12] = { 31,28,31,30,31,30,31,31,30,31,30,31 };
    if ((year % 4 == 0 && year % 100 != 0) || (year % 400 == 0))
        x[1] = 29;
    for (i = 0; i < month-1; i++)
        n = n + x[i];
    return n + day;
}
